Output 123ba9efc879ac3fd5c0626f0b044462e3681ee04c8eac12cd43bbceaf4acd5d:2

value
21428547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d84adb03ff7ce823100286647fae251e05196c6 OP_EQUAL
address
MU6SWVAiNPap9iQcPQvpznAokeB4MtfUBG
transaction
123ba9efc879ac3fd5c0626f0b044462e3681ee04c8eac12cd43bbceaf4acd5d
spent
true